PetPurrsuit: Adopt and Foster Animals App

Overview

PetPurrsuit is an iOS application designed to streamline the process of discovering and adopting animals in your local area. This app utilizes Core Data for efficient data management and SwiftUI for a modern and intuitive user interface.

Features

  • Discover Animals: Browse and explore a variety of animals available for adoption or fostering in your vicinity.
  • Detailed Profiles: Access comprehensive profiles of animals, including images, descriptions, and adoption/fostering information.
  • Save Favorites: Mark animals as favorites to easily keep track of those you are interested in.
  • Search Functionality: Effortlessly find specific types of animals or filter based on criteria such as age, size, and species.
  • User-Friendly Interface: Utilizes SwiftUI for a seamless and engaging user experience.

Requirements

  • iOS 16.0+
  • Xcode 15.0+
  • Swift 5.9

License

This project is licensed under the GNU General Public License v3.0.

IMPORTANT: The GNU General Public License is a copyleft license that ensures any modifications or derivatives of this code must also be open source and distributed under the same terms. This means that others cannot use or distribute modified versions of this code in proprietary, closed-source projects.
